Output 76e50376ae6a7aece435a1d3fdccb4bb0e8b6e5700668cdab389e5a14adc646d:5

value
608465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26da26b0eeece56f4ff14ac29cfced9df9b177a9 OP_EQUAL
address
35ESwEsoQbQE26dkySfxrhxSLEbZbKFXro
transaction
76e50376ae6a7aece435a1d3fdccb4bb0e8b6e5700668cdab389e5a14adc646d
confirmations
406358
spent
true